Glen Powell Stars in 'The Running Man' Action Remake

  • Paramount Pictures is releasing the movie The Running Man, directed by Edgar Wright and starring Glen Powell as Ben Richards, on November 7, 2025.
  • The film adapts Stephen King's 1982 novel about a near-future dystopian America where a deadly TV show forces contestants to survive 30 days hunted by assassins.
  • Ben Richards enters the game show as a desperate blue-collar hero needing money to save his sick daughter, with Josh Brolin and Colman Domingo in key cast roles.
  • The trailer shows Richards becoming a fan favorite and system threat while being hunted by Lee Pace’s masked character McCone, highlighting the show’s escalating danger and public broadcast.
  • The remake aims for a more faithful, darker adaptation than the 1987 Schwarzenegger film, suggesting intensified violence and social critique in the updated story.
